Institute of Organic Synthesis and Photoreactivity
About
In recent decades, authors affiliated with Institute of Organic Synthesis and Photoreactivity have published 1.9k papers, which have received a total of 62.2k indexed citations.
Scholars at this organization have produced 690 papers in Materials Chemistry, 560 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 494 papers in Organic Chemistry on the topics of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(226 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(191 papers) and Luminescence and Fluorescent Materials (183 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Materials Chemistry (25.5k cit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(18.3k citations) and Organic Chemistry (14.2k citations). Authors at Institute of Organic Synthesis and Photoreactivity collaborate with scholars in Italy, France and Poland and have published in prestigious journals including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Chemical Reviews and Journal of the American Chemical Society. Some of Institute of Organic Synthesis and Photoreactivity's most productive authors include Vincenzo Palermo, Nicola Armaroli, Paolo Samorı́, Massimo Gazzano and Gianluca Accorsi
